Key Buying Factors

Before making your purchase, consider these essential factors:

Compatibility

Ensure the dimmer is compatible with your existing smart home system, such as SmartThings, Hubitat, or Home Assistant.

Neutral Wire Requirement

Determine if your home has a neutral wire in the switch box, as some dimmers require it while others do not.

Ease of Installation

Look for dimmers that are easy to install, especially if you are not experienced with electrical work.


Common Mistakes to Avoid

Learn from others’ experiences - here are key pitfalls to watch out for:

Ignoring Neutral Wire Requirements

Many users overlook whether their home has a neutral wire, which can limit their options for smart dimmers.

Choosing Based on Price Alone

While budget is important, selecting a dimmer based solely on price may lead to compatibility or performance issues.

Not Considering Future Compatibility

It’s essential to consider how well the dimmer will integrate with future smart home devices or systems you may want to add.

Inovelli Red Series Dimmer (No Neutral)

Inovelli Red Series Dimmer (No Neutral)

The Inovelli Red Series Dimmer is widely recognized in the smart home community, particularly for its capability to operate without a neutral wire, making it an excellent choice for older homes. Users appreciate its robust performance and versatility in various configurations, including 3-way setups with existing dumb switches. However, the product has faced supply chain issues, leading to frequent out-of-stock situations, which may hinder accessibility for potential buyers.

Features

  • No neutral wire required for installation
  • Highly adjustable parameters including minimum dim level for instant on/off response

User Experiences

  • Many users have reported that the Inovelli Red Series Dimmer integrates seamlessly with SmartThings and works exceptionally well with smart bulbs, allowing for a versatile lighting solution that meets various needs.

Pros

  • Great for no neutral applications
  • Highly customizable settings for dimming and response times

Cons

  • Currently out of stock frequently due to supply chain issues

Best Use Cases

  • Ideal for older homes where neutral wires are not present, especially in 3-way switch configurations.

Price-Performance Ratio

The Inovelli Red Series Dimmer is considered to offer excellent value for its price, particularly given its advanced features and compatibility with smart home systems.

GE 12724

GE 12724

The GE 12724 Z-Wave Smart Dimmer is highly regarded among users for its reliable performance and compatibility with 3-way dimming setups. It requires a neutral wire, which is a common requirement for many smart switches, but this has not deterred users from choosing it due to its effectiveness and ease of use. Discussions on Reddit highlight its popularity in homes where multiple switches are needed to control lighting from different locations. The device is often mentioned alongside other brands, but many users express a preference for GE due to its solid build quality and performance longevity.

Features

  • 3-way dimming capability
  • Requires neutral wire for installation

User Experiences

  • I’ve installed around 15-20 GE Z-Wave switches in my house, and I’ve never had one fail. They are relatively inexpensive and work well, but just remember they need a neutral wire.

Pros

  • Reliable performance in 3-way configurations
  • Good build quality and longevity

Cons

  • Requires a neutral wire, which may not be available in all homes

Best Use Cases

  • Ideal for homes needing multiple light control points in 3-way dimming setups

Price-Performance Ratio

The price of the GE 12724 is competitive compared to other smart dimmers, and given its reliability and performance, it offers excellent value for those needing a dependable solution for smart lighting.
